Does "can" file mean optional or mandatory? For apprx $9k for all of 2023 during summer internship, does he need (must) to file? He qualifies as a child per list of 7 items in your response
It depends on the type of income he received. If he received a Form W-2 as an employee and his income is under $13,850 he does not have to file a tax return since it is below the filing requirements. If he had taxes withheld from his wages on the W-2 then he should file for a tax refund.
If his income was from self-employment and he received a Form 1099-NEC or Cash only, then he was self-employed and is Required to report the income since it is more than $400. He would have to complete a federal tax return and include with the return a Schedule C to report the self-employment income and expenses.
